这是我第一次将整个网站移动到另一个文件夹中。
我使用WAMP在我的localhost中创建了我的新wordpress站点,然后将其转移到我的新文件夹中
www.mysite.com/new/
问题1 :当我检查网址时,主题管理面板有很多损坏的图片。它喜欢
http://localhost/mynewsite/wp-content/uploads/2014/02/image.png
应该是
http://mysite/new/wp-content/uploads/2014/02/image.png
有数百张图片/图标被破坏..
以下是我将新网站转移到新文件夹时所做的流程。
问题2 :即使您的主题管理面板有很多损坏的图像,我继续填充内容甚至上传图像,我确实设置了一堆绝对网址
http://mysite/new/wp-content/uploads/2014/02/image.png
现在的问题是:当我转移新网站并覆盖旧网站时。如何更改绝对URL,而不是逐个更改它们?我的意思是有没有办法只删除所有内容和数据库中的新/?
答案 0 :(得分:0)
使用wordpress你需要在你的数据库中修改你的siteurl和home - 这可以通过phpmyadmin完成,或者你可以将它添加到你的wp-config.php:
define('WP_SITEURL', 'http://www.mysite.com/new/');
define('WP_HOME', 'http://www.mysite.com/new/');